3. Drain residual water
Draining residual water is an important side of correct washer storage. Water left throughout the equipment can result in a number of detrimental results throughout transport and long-term storage, impacting each the machine’s performance and its lifespan. This course of includes eradicating water from the interior parts, together with the drum, hoses, and pump, to mitigate potential harm.
Undrained water creates an surroundings conducive to mildew and mildew development, resulting in disagreeable odors and potential well being issues. Stagnant water can even corrode inside metallic components, compromising their structural integrity and resulting in untimely failure. Throughout transport, residual water can shift and spill, inflicting harm to the washer itself and surrounding gadgets. In colder climates, any remaining water can freeze, increasing and doubtlessly cracking hoses, pipes, or the pump housing. As an illustration, a small quantity of water trapped throughout the pump can freeze and trigger the pump housing to crack, necessitating pricey repairs. Equally, water remaining within the drain hose can freeze, increasing and splitting the hose, resulting in leaks upon reinstallation.
Totally draining a washer earlier than storage is paramount for preserving its performance and stopping pricey repairs. This includes disconnecting the water provide traces, working a spin cycle to take away extra water, and utilizing a drain hose to evacuate any remaining water from the drum and inside parts. This observe safeguards in opposition to mildew development, corrosion, water harm throughout transport, and freeze harm in colder climates. Neglecting this important step can considerably shorten the equipment’s lifespan and necessitate sudden repairs.

6. Safe the drum
Securing the drum is a important side of making ready a washer for storage or transportation. The drum, a heavy element suspended by springs and dampers, is weak to break if left unsecured throughout motion. This harm can vary from minor dents and scratches to important misalignment and harm to the suspension system. Such points can have an effect on the machine’s stability, resulting in extreme vibration, noise, and potential malfunction throughout operation. For instance, transporting a washer over uneven terrain with out securing the drum could cause the drum to shift and influence the internal casing, doubtlessly damaging the drum or the suspension system. Equally, long-term storage with out drum stabilization can result in weakening or stretching of the suspension parts, affecting the machine’s efficiency upon reinstallation.
A number of strategies exist to safe the drum, every providing various levels of safety. Some producers present transit bolts particularly designed to immobilize the drum throughout transport. These bolts are sometimes inserted into designated holes on the again of the machine and screwed in to safe the drum. If transit bolts are unavailable, various strategies, comparable to utilizing straps or ropes to safe the drum, can present some degree of safety. Nonetheless, these options might not provide the identical degree of stability as transit bolts, and care should be taken to keep away from damaging the machine’s exterior end. As an illustration, utilizing ropes with out correct padding can scratch the machine’s floor. Utilizing packing supplies like foam or blankets between the drum and the casing can provide extra cushioning and stop inside parts from rubbing in opposition to one another throughout transit.

8. Local weather-controlled space
A climate-controlled surroundings performs an important function in preserving a washer throughout storage. Defending the equipment from temperature extremes and humidity fluctuations safeguards its parts and ensures optimum performance upon reinstallation. Storing a washer in an uncontrolled surroundings can result in numerous points, impacting each its efficiency and lifespan.
-
Temperature Regulation
Excessive temperatures, each cold and warm, can negatively influence a washer’s parts. Excessive temperatures can harm plastic components, inflicting warping or cracking. Freezing temperatures pose an excellent better threat, as residual water throughout the equipment can freeze and broaden, doubtlessly damaging hoses, pumps, and valves. A climate-controlled surroundings mitigates these dangers by sustaining a steady temperature vary, sometimes between 50F and 80F (10C and 27C), safeguarding weak parts. For instance, storing a washer in an unheated storage throughout winter exposes it to freezing temperatures, whereas storing it in a shed throughout summer time can topic it to extreme warmth. A climate-controlled house, comparable to a storage unit or a temperature-regulated basement, gives the mandatory safety.
-
Humidity Management
Excessive humidity ranges can promote rust and corrosion on metallic components and encourage mildew and mildew development throughout the washer. A climate-controlled space maintains optimum humidity ranges, sometimes beneath 60%, stopping these points. As an illustration, storing a washer in a moist basement can result in rust formation on metallic parts, whereas extreme humidity can promote mildew development throughout the drum and detergent dispenser. A climate-controlled surroundings mitigates these dangers, preserving the equipment’s integrity and hygiene. Utilizing a dehumidifier in a storage space might help management humidity ranges if a completely climate-controlled house isn’t obtainable.

Important Suggestions for Washing Machine Storage
These sensible ideas present concise steering for correct washer storage, emphasizing preventative measures to safeguard the equipment and guarantee its longevity.
Tip 1: Doc Disassembly
Photographing or video recording the disconnection course of, particularly for water traces and electrical connections, gives a useful reference throughout reinstallation. This visible documentation simplifies the reconnection course of and reduces the chance of errors.
Tip 2: Elevated Storage
Putting the washer on a picket pallet or platform elevates it from the bottom, defending it from potential moisture and spills within the storage space. This precaution minimizes the chance of rust formation and harm to the bottom of the equipment.
Tip 3: Inside Desiccant
Putting desiccant packets or containers of baking soda contained in the drum and detergent dispenser absorbs residual moisture, mitigating the chance of mildew and mildew development throughout storage. This proactive measure helps keep a dry inside surroundings.
Tip 4: Exterior Safety
Overlaying the washer with a breathable cloth cowl, comparable to a canvas sheet or blanket, protects it from mud, particles, and unintentional scratches throughout storage. Keep away from utilizing plastic covers, as they will lure moisture and promote mildew development.
Tip 5: Periodic Inspection
Usually inspecting the saved washer, notably throughout prolonged storage intervals, permits for early detection of potential points, comparable to leaks, rust, or pest exercise. Promptly addressing these points prevents additional harm and preserves the equipment.
Tip 6: Degree Placement
Guaranteeing the washer is positioned on a degree floor throughout storage maintains correct alignment of inside parts and prevents undue stress on the suspension system. This precaution minimizes the chance of injury and ensures optimum efficiency upon reinstallation.
Tip 7: Keep away from Direct Daylight
Direct daylight can harm the washer’s exterior end and degrade plastic parts. Selecting a storage location away from home windows or protecting the equipment with a protecting sheet shields it from dangerous UV rays.
